PURPOSE:To obtain fixed stylus force by detecting the sensitivity of a cantilever every time stylus force is applied, estimating the magnitude of magnetic field necessary to obtain prescribed stylus force, and controlling the amount of current of a stylus force coil so as to obtain the estimated magnitude of magnetic field. CONSTITUTION:A low pass filter 15 connected to the output of a D-A converter 14 consists of an integrating circuit. DC voltage corresponding to a digital numerical value is applied to transistors 1, 5 by count up down command signals c, d, and a magnetic field corresponding to the DC voltage value is applied to a magnet 9. An arithmetic unit 18 outputs a count up command signal (c) when stylus force is to be increased, and outputs a count down signal (d) when decreasing stylus force. Accordingly, when the stylus is at a point (a), the count down command signal (d) is inputted to make the value of an internal digital signal zero. When the stylus 11 is brought to a point (b) by the count up command signal (c), a signal (f) goes to high level, and a value to be outputted next is calculated from the value of the count up command signal (c) and stylus force coefficient data (g) corresponding to the value, and outputted. Accordingly, practically usable nearly accurate stylus force value can be obtained even when many conditions are superposed. |
